To override the Content-type in your clients, use the HTTP Accept Header, append the .xml suffix or ?format=xml
HTTP + XML
The following are sample HTTP requests and responses.
The placeholders shown need to be replaced with actual values.
POST /api/dimension/save HTTP/1.1
Host: mdn.bazefield.com
Accept: application/xml
Content-Type: application/xml
Content-Length: length
<DimensionSaveRequest xmlns:i="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ance" xmlns="http://schemas.datacontract.org/2004/07/Bazefield.Core.WebService.Request">
<DimensionData xmlns:d2p1="http://schemas.datacontract.org/2004/07/Bazefield.Domain.DataModel.Entities">
<d2p1:Columns>String</d2p1:Columns>
<d2p1:DimensionTypeId>0</d2p1:DimensionTypeId>
<d2p1:GroupKey>String</d2p1:GroupKey>
<d2p1:Id>0</d2p1:Id>
<d2p1:Key>String</d2p1:Key>
<d2p1:ObjectId>0</d2p1:ObjectId>
<d2p1:SerializedColumns xmlns:d3p1="http://schemas.microsoft.com/2003/10/Serialization/Arrays">
<d3p1:KeyValueOfstringstring>
<d3p1:Key>String</d3p1:Key>
<d3p1:Value>String</d3p1:Value>
</d3p1:KeyValueOfstringstring>
</d2p1:SerializedColumns>
<d2p1:Table>String</d2p1:Table>
</DimensionData>
</DimensionSaveRequest>
HTTP/1.1 200 OK
Content-Type: application/xml
Content-Length: length
<DimensionDataEntry xmlns:i="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ance" xmlns="http://schemas.datacontract.org/2004/07/Bazefield.Domain.DataModel.Entities">
<Columns>String</Columns>
<DimensionTypeId>0</DimensionTypeId>
<GroupKey>String</GroupKey>
<Id>0</Id>
<Key>String</Key>
<ObjectId>0</ObjectId>
<SerializedColumns xmlns:d2p1="http://schemas.microsoft.com/2003/10/Serialization/Arrays">
<d2p1:KeyValueOfstringstring>
<d2p1:Key>String</d2p1:Key>
<d2p1:Value>String</d2p1:Value>
</d2p1:KeyValueOfstringstring>
</SerializedColumns>
<Table>String</Table>
</DimensionDataEntry>
